Overall Meaning

Michael Buble's song "Fever" is a sultry and romantic tune that showcases the depth of love that the singer has for his partner, and the effect that his partner's affection has on him. The first and second stanzas of the song emphasize the overpowering feelings that occur when his partner embraces him, to the point of making him feel feverish. The third verse highlights the fact that everyone can have a fever, and that fever has been present since the beginning of time. The fourth verse tells a story of two famous lovers, Romeo and Juliet, and how their passion made them feel feverish.


The song is an interpretation of the 1956 song originally performed by Little Willie John. However, Michael Buble's version has a more jazzy and upbeat sound. The song is an easy favorite for people who love a retro and old-school vibe, which is evident in Buble's phrasing and delivery. The song was recorded as the opening track for Buble's album, "Call Me Irresponsible," which was released in 2007.


Overall, "Fever" is a beautiful and well-crafted song that emphasizes the power of love, and the physiological effects that it can have on a person. It is a great choice for a romantic evening, and its jazzy undertones make it a popular choice for jazz enthusiasts.
